The policy team at Community Pharmacy Scotland is recruiting! Are you interested in how services are developed and implemented at a national level, or want to be involved in where the profession is headed next?
We are looking for an excellent communicator and strategic thinker with a passion for community pharmacy in Scotland to join our team, representing pharmacy owners and the view of the network across a number of key projects.
About the role
Working as a part of a strong, well-established CPS team you will support and deliver on areas of work which are led by the Policy and Development team. The department develops and implements plans to raise the profile of both the organisation and the community pharmacy network, which will require you to influence a range of different stakeholders. In this role, you will work across a broad portfolio of projects like developing NHS Pharmacy First Scotland, building business cases and support for future NHS community pharmacy services and shaping the rapidly evolving future of pharmacy education and training. You will have the opportunity to develop a wide range of skills on the job which will set you up to deliver this national role confidently.

Who we are
CPS is the organisation which represents community pharmacy owners and their teams throughout Scotland. We act as the single voice of these vital healthcare professionals as they deliver pharmaceutical care services to the people of Scotland on behalf of NHS Scotland.
We aim to continually develop and secure a contractual framework for the provision of pharmaceutical services, supported by a sustainable funding model which encourages investment in the network. We do this by negotiating with the Scottish Government on behalf of our members on all terms of service under the NHS.
